
Junior Java Software Engineer
Responsibilities
Qualifications & Requirements
Experience Level: Entry Level
Full Job Description
Join Miratech in Chennai, India, as a Junior Software Engineer and contribute to building the next generation of cloud-based SaaS platforms for a global leader in contact center software. In this role, you will collaborate with experienced engineers to develop, test, and support Java-based microservices utilizing Spring Boot. This is an excellent opportunity for individuals looking to enhance their software development skills within a cloud environment while contributing to production-ready systems.
Responsibilities:
- Develop and maintain Java microservices using Spring Boot.
- Assist in designing and implementing scalable and reliable features.
- Troubleshoot and provide support for existing services under the guidance of senior engineers.
- Collaborate with product managers, QA teams, and peers to deliver high-quality software.
- Learn and apply best practices for cloud-based application development.
Qualifications:
- A minimum of 1 year of experience in Java development with Spring Boot.
- Bachelor’s degree in Computer Science, Engineering, or a related field.
- A foundational understanding of microservices architecture.
- Familiarity with cloud concepts (e.g., GCP, AWS, Azure) is advantageous.
- Strong problem-solving abilities and a commitment to continuous learning.
- General understanding of version control systems, particularly Git.
Nice to Have:
- Prior exposure to Docker or other containerized environments.
- Knowledge of CI/CD pipelines and modern development workflows.
- Familiarity with cloud services such as Google BigQuery, Cloud Storage, and Cloud Functions.
Miratech offers a culture of Relentless Performance, competitive compensation and benefits, a work-from-anywhere flexibility, extensive professional development opportunities, the chance to make a global impact, a welcoming multicultural environment, and a commitment to social sustainability.
Company
Miratech
Miratech is a global IT services and consulting company dedicated to empowering visionaries to change the world. We bridge the gap between enterprise and startup innovation, currently supporting the d...